Historical Context:
Jacob Beser (1921–1992) played a unique and significant role in World War II as a radar specialist and member of the 509th Composite Group. He flew aboard the Enola Gay on August 6, 1945, during the bombing of Hiroshima, and three days later aboard Bockscar for the Nagasaki mission—becoming the only man to participate in both atomic strikes. After the war, Beser pursued a professional career in engineering and remained an important witness to the events that transformed modern warfare and world history.
